Heuer 100 -- The two Carrera Datos (3147 S and 3147 NS)

Like probably most of the forum members, I have looked at all the 100 watches for sale – especially at the few manual wind 60s Carreras, which are my favourite Heuers.

The two 3147 Datos caught my eye, and having a closer look, I wonder if they have different cases. It seems the S has thicker lugs with a different angle of the lug ends, compared to the NS. In order to have a better comparison, I have made a quick photoshop composing, cutting both watches in half. It even seems that the overall diameter of the case of the S is slightly larger. The thicker lugs of the S resemble the 'fat lugs' version of the Carrera 12 Dato (ref. 2547), but in fact they are still different.

The cases of my Carreras (including my 2nd execution 3147 Dato) look more like the NS rather than the S.

Does anyone have an indication that there were two different cases available for the 3147?

Or is there a case from a different manufacturer known, which looks almost like the Carrera case (except for the thicker lugs and maybe a slighly larger diameter) and which can house the dial and movement of a Carrera (i.e. here the Landeron 189) without major modifications?

Maybe some of our experts can shed a light on this.
